I Have the same light box. cannot really recommend it for gemstones photography. its led light but somehow the light spectrum is more similar to fluorescent. making it very difficult to get the correct color of the gem. if you are using a separate light source with it than its fine.
The box itself is just a reflector/diffuser. As in all things photographic, light quality is very important. It is best to buy your own lights making sure that they a full spectrum with CRI values in the 90% plus range. Also be sure to properly position and diffuse the lights so as not to create hot spots in the stone.
